Description The Senior Financial Analyst is responsible for the reporting of HomeServices consolidated financial statements as well as the monthly accounting and analysis and annual budget preparation for the HomeServices parent company. The Senior Financial Analyst is responsible for working directly with the Shared Success Center’s finance staff to ensure timely and accurate consolidation and reporting to Berkshire Hathaway Energy (BHE). The Senior Financial Analyst is responsible for preparation of financial reporting packages and other ad hoc reporting and analysis for internal management and external uses. Provides Support to the Following Positions Corporate Controller, CFO, CEO, Corporate Finance staff, the regional operating companies CFOs and finance staff and BHE Primary Job Duties and Responsibilities (Essential Job Functions) Consolidate and analyze monthly financial statements related to HomeServices and manage month-end closing process with regional operating companies. (25%) Prepare monthly reporting packages with appropriate analysis as needed by management and BHE. (25%) Prepare and analyze monthly journal entries related to HomeServices parent, including inter-company transactions. Responsible for working directly with the regional operating companies to ensure inter-company activity is appropriately accounted for. (15%) Prepare and analyze monthly financial statements related to HomeServices parent. (10%) Reconcile and analyze all balance sheet accounts monthly for HomeServices. (10%) Support quarterly and annual external reporting and audit. (5%) Support consolidation of long-range plans and current year forecasts for HomeServices. (5%) Perform any additional responsibilities as requested or assigned. Position Requirements Bachelor’s degree in Accounting or Finance. 3 – 5 years of accounting experience. Specifically, a minimum of 2 years of financial statement consolidation and preparation experience. Experience with OneStream software is a plus. Strong computer skills required including Excel, Word, PowerPoint, Teams/CoPilot, and SharePoint. Demonstrated strong analytical and problem-solving skills, with attention to detail and commitment to accuracy. Desire and ability to initiate process and system improvements. Ability to work independently; resourceful and action-oriented. Must possess strong organizational skills, including workload prioritization and project management. Ability to consistently meet deadlines. Excellent interpersonal and communication skills, both written and oral. CPA not required but preferred. Wage: $99,000 - $117,000 annually; actual wage is based upon education and experience. Potential for annual discretionary bonus.
